coronavirus pandemic, a scientific adviser to the government has warned. Professor Clifford Stott predicts disruption on a scale not seen since the London riots of August 2011, if action is not taken by police to quell any potential unrest in neighbourhoods they serve.

The riots across London were sparked by the police shooting of Mark Duggan. Stott, a member of the Scientific Advisory Group for Emergencies (Sage) sub-committee on behaviour, said mass job losses and rising unemployment due to coronavirus, as well as concerns about racial and economic inequality, may all be factors which could fuel "confrontations" in the coming months.
